To keep your eyes peeled
= to keep alert
= to pay close attention in anticipation of something.
- Keep your eyes peeled for Martin. He should be home any minute and I don’t want him to come home and find this mess we’ve caused!
- Keep your eyes peeled for him – he hasn’t paid his bill yet!
Peel = to remove the skin from a fruit or vegetable
Here we can assume that it refers to removing any layer from your eyes that may stop you from seeing something that may happen. (Though not literally, only in a figurative sense)
